Registration & Verification – Step‑by‑Step
Signing up on Playamo is a process that can be finished in under five minutes if you have your details handy. You start by entering an email address, choosing a password, and confirming your age – the platform asks for a date of birth to verify you’re over 18, as required by Australian law. After you hit “Register,” an activation link lands in your inbox; click it and you’re ready to make your first deposit.
Verification, often called KYC (Know Your Customer), kicks in when you request a withdrawal exceeding the small “instant payout” threshold. You’ll be asked for a photo ID, a recent utility bill and sometimes a proof of payment method. While it might feel like an extra step, the documents are encrypted and stored securely, meaning your personal data stays protected. Most players report verification taking between one and two business days, which aligns with the platform’s overall reputation for quick processing.
Bonuses & Promotions – What You Actually Get
Playamo’s welcome package is the headline attraction in most playamo reviews. New players receive a 100% match bonus up to AU$500 on the first deposit, plus 100 free spins on a selected slot. The catch? The bonus comes with a 30x wagering requirement on both the bonus amount and the winnings from the free spins. In plain English, if you claim the full AU$500 bonus, you’ll need to wager AU$15,000 before you can cash out.

Security, Licensing & Responsible Gambling
Playamo’s Curacao licence means the casino follows a set of international standards, but it’s not an Australian gambling licence. For players who prioritize local regulation, this might be a point to weigh. Nonetheless, the site employs SSL encryption to protect data in transit, and all payment processors are PCI‑DSS compliant, which keeps your financial details safe.
Responsible gambling tools are built into the user account area. You can set daily, weekly or monthly deposit limits, self‑exclude for a chosen period, or even close your account permanently if you feel it’s needed. The support team can also direct you to Australian counselling services if you ever need extra help.
